Job Description
A globally leading consumer device company headquartered in Cupertino, CA is seeking an experienced Project Manager to join their WPC EPM team and drive compliance projects.
Job Responsibilities:
- Drive compliance-focused projects from initial planning through execution.
- Support the delivery of integrated system solutions for the company.
- Collaborate closely with client and server engineering teams and third-party integration partners.
- Define project scope and prepare projects from the outset across multiple teams.
- Create, organize, and maintain relevant project documentation.
- Communicate project progress and status effectively to stakeholders.
- Identify, track, and manage project risks throughout execution.
- Drive continuous improvement across project processes and delivery.
Minimum Qualifications:
- Results oriented, highly motivated and able to work under minimal supervision in a cross-functional environment at detailed levels whilst taking account of interdependencies at higher levels.
- Strong background in system implementation project management using proven software development techniques.
- Able to build a positive relationship with cross-functional internal organizations.
- Able to navigate and execute in an environment of ambiguity and lead teams to the successful delivery of solutions.
Preferred Qualifications:
- Effective presentation, oral, and written business communication skills with various audiences and levels.
- Ability to read, write, and verbally respond during partner engagements in Mandarin
- Ability to quickly respond to changes in business scenarios, projects and resources - adapting accordingly and positively.
- Ability to participate in and facilitate requirements brainstorming sessions.
- Proven past in technical and engineering project delivery.
- Ability to review and provide feedback on technical specifications, taking into account external and internal feedback
- Strong technical knowledge to be able to diagnose and drive bugs and issues to completion
- Familiarity of Software Development Lifecycle planning
Type: Contract
Duration: 12 months with extension
Work Location: Cupertino, CA (hybrid)
Pay range: $50.00 - $65.00 ph (DOE)
